Automotive Closure: Unveiling Future Prospects Amidst Global Challenges and Opportunities

How are Global Challenges Affecting the Automotive Closure Market?

The automotive closure market, a critical segment of the automobile manufacturing domain, is grappling with significant obstacles globally. Occurrences like political unrest, changing trade policies, economic fluctuations, and ongoing technological evolutions are impacting this market. Moreover, the transition towards electric vehicles (EVs) adds another complex layer, demanding significant adjustments from manufacturers.

In What Ways are Opportunities Emerging in the Automotive Closure Market?

Contrastingly, the current landscape also offers compelling growth opportunities. The push toward sustainability combined with the growth of EVs are opening avenues for innovations. The advancement of autonomous vehicles, with an emphasis on comfort and safety, is creating a demand for sophisticated closures. Additionally, emerging markets, with growing vehicle ownership rates, present vast untapped potential for expansion.

What are the Projections for the Future of the Automotive Closure Market?

Looking ahead, it's anticipated that despite the challenges, the automotive closure market will continue to evolve and expand. The integration of high-tech solutions and digital innovation will increasingly define the aspect of closures in automotive design. Manufacturers must remain adaptable to swiftly respond to industry shifts and consumer demands, aligning business strategies with market trends. Beyond doubt, those in the closure market face demanding times, but they are also on the brink of thrilling possibilities.
